The remains of an adult, limping man have emerged in Pompeii in an area of new excavations, the so-called Regio V, at the corner between the Vicolo dei Balconi (Alley of Balconies, the road that the team from the Pompeii Archaeological Park has just unearthed) and the alley of the ‘Nozze d’Argento.’

Italian for “lady's kisses,” Baci di Dama are hazelnut and chocolate biscuits that originate from the region of Piedmont.
